Some people have a hard time thinking of a factory as a tourist destination. Those people have obviously never been to the Mercedes-Benz US International Visitor Center and Factory Tour in Tuscaloosa, Alabama. This unique tour starts at the visitors center and walks visitors through every phase of the process of building a new Mercedes-Benz automobile.

The early days of the Mercedes-Benz factory in Tuscaloosa seemed to be overshadowed by an impossible task. The goal was simple in theory, but more complex when it got down to it. Mercedes-Benz wanted to build an entirely new line of automobiles, at a new factory, in a new country, with an entirely new staff. It was an enormous undertaking, and it's no wonder that Mercedes-Benz and the City of Tuscaloosa are so proud of this monumental achievement that they have decided to showcase the results to the world.

Following the successful opening of the factory, workers quickly went to work putting together the Visitor Center and official tour for the Mercedes-Benz US International plant. This unique attraction is the only one of it's kind outside of Germany, and a true credit to the world of international trade.

All tours of the Mercedes-Benz factory start in the Visitor Center, where guests will be greeted by a guide who gives them a detailed tour of the entire factory. The tour shows every step of building a Mercedes-Benz automobile, from the initial weld to the final inspection. The tour showcases all of the Mercedes-Benz vehicles that are built in Tuscaloosa, Alabama, which includes the M-Class and the newer R-Class and GL-Class Mercedes-Benz vehicles.

The tour of the Mercedes-Benz US International plant concludes at the same place it began - the famous Mercedes-Benz Visitor Center. This is far more than your average corporate visitor center. It is actually a full scale museum that chronicles the entire history of Daimler-Benz, starting in 1886 and continuing on to the present Mercedes-Benz automobiles being constructed on the assembly line.
